Detroit Symphony Extends Bignamini; Reports Surplus

The Detroit Symphony Orchestra has extended the contract of Music Director Jader Bignamini through the end of the 2030-31 season, lengthening the current agreement by five years to reach a total of ten by its completion. The DSO is planning to … »Read
